This is a charming vintage Enesco small coffee canister with spoon in white with gold accent. It still has the Enesco Japan sticker on the bottom and is marked E-8240. The praying hands are highlighted in gold and the grapes on the lid, and reads, God Bless Our Home. The letters were likely gold at one time, but are now white. It has a scroll shaped on one side and a spoon on the other side for your coffee. The spoon is plastic.

This is in nice vintage condition, with no chips or cracks. There's wear of course due to age. There's some green colored spots on the lid, which is also likely due to age. See pictures as well for description.

This is a charming piece and would look great on a shelf in the kitchen or a cute little nook on your counter.

Measurements: Approx 5 3/4" tall (top of lid), 4" wide, 3" diameter.
